Jalandhar, August 23
Jalandhar district has secured the top position across the state in delivering citizen-centric services through its sewa kendras.
Deputy Commissioner Dr Himanshu Aggarwal attributed this achievement to the entire administrative staff in Jalandhar and their team work. He explained that the performance of the sewa kendras was reviewed weekly and feedback was taken from citizens to ensure that they did not face any issues.
Dr Aggarwal appreciated efforts of officers and staff in maintaining the record of the lowest pendency rate. He also mentioned that instructions had been issued to all SDMs to conduct regular visits to sewa kendras and personally oversee the service delivery.
Over the last year (from August 23, 2023, to August 22, 2024), the administration received 3,98,673 applications for various services through sewa kendras, of which 99.91% of eligible applications were processed. The remaining applications were being processed and issues would be resolved within the stipulated time, the DC said.
According to the state-level report on citizen service delivery, Jalandhar secured the first position, followed by Kapurthala second and Hoshiarpur third. Dr Aggarwal reiterated the administration’s commitment to providing uninterrupted and timely services and directed officials to prioritise the processing of applications to maintain zero pendency.
Over 430 different services related to various departments are being provided to the public through the district’s 35 sewa kendras.
